About

Stephen Becker is an Associate Professor and the head of the Becker research group at the University of Colorado Boulder, having joined the university in 2014. His research group focuses on a variety of topics including optimization, quantum tomography, equation discovery, scientific data compression, and machine learning methods. The group works on advanced mathematical and computational techniques such as one-pass compression, zeroth order optimization, Gauss-Newton methods for quantum tomography maximum likelihood estimation, and non-uniform convolutions for neural networks. Becker's lab collaborates with students and postdoctoral researchers across multiple disciplines including computer science, electrical, computer, and energy engineering, physics, and applied mathematics. The group also engages with many PhD students from other research groups, indicating a broad interdisciplinary approach to their research endeavors.

  • Theory of versatile fidelity estimation with confidence

    Physical review. A/Physical review, A · 2024-07-10 · 8 citations

    articleSenior author

    Estimating the fidelity with a target state is important in quantum information tasks. Many fidelity-estimation techniques present a suitable measurement scheme to perform the estimation. In contrast, we present techniques that allow the experimentalist to choose a convenient measurement setting. Our primary focus lies on a method that constructs an estimator with nearly minimax optimal confidence intervals for any specified measurement setting.   • Versatile Fidelity Estimation with Confidence

    Physical Review Letters · 2024-07-10 · 7 citations

    articleSenior author

    As quantum devices become more complex and the requirements on these devices become more demanding, it is crucial to be able to verify the performance of such devices in a scalable and reliable fashion. A cornerstone task in this challenge is quantifying how close an experimentally prepared quantum state is to the desired one.
